For overseas projects, particularly in Europe, equipment performance alone is not enough. Electrical safety, machinery safety and electromagnetic compatibility must also be considered during product development.
Our conformity assessment documentation references several relevant European directives and standards.
The Containerized Automated Cultivation Equipment has been assessed with reference to the Machinery Directive 2006/42/EC, including Annex VIII.
Referenced standards include:
EN ISO 12100:2010
Safety of machinery – General principles for design – Risk assessment and risk reduction.
EN 60204-1:2018
Safety of machinery – Electrical equipment of machines.
EN 60204-1:2018/A1:2025
These standards address important aspects of machinery risk assessment, safety-oriented design and electrical equipment associated with machinery.
Electrical safety is another essential consideration for an automated cultivation container containing electrical and environmental control equipment.
The conformity documentation therefore also covers the Low Voltage Directive 2014/35/EU.
The referenced electrical safety standard includes:
EN IEC 60335-1:2023+A11:2023
This provides an additional compliance basis for electrical safety considerations associated with the system.
Modern cultivation systems can contain controllers, sensors, motors, power electronics and other electrical components.
Electromagnetic compatibility therefore becomes increasingly important as cultivation facilities become more automated.
The EMC assessment references standards including:
EN IEC 61000-3-2:2019+A1:2021+A2:2024
EN 61000-3-3:2013+A1:2019+A2:2021+AC:2022-1
EN IEC 55014-1:2021
EN IEC 55014-2:2021
The inclusion of EMC requirements supports the development of a more standardized electrical and control system for international projects.

What is a containerized cultivation system?
A containerized cultivation system is an enclosed and modular growing environment that integrates environmental control equipment into a container-type structure. Depending on the application, it can control temperature, humidity, ventilation and other environmental parameters required by the cultivation process.
